Purpose of the Legislation

The Virgin Islands Visa Waiver Act of 2025 aims to create a new visa waiver program for the U.S. Virgin Islands, allowing certain international visitors to enter without a traditional visa for short-term business or tourism stays. This program mirrors existing waivers for Guam and the Northern Mariana Islands, with the goal of boosting tourism and economic activity in the Virgin Islands while maintaining national security.
